I was set to be happy here- this is the third time I've stayed during a nearby conference, and they've renovated, and the rooms look great. But these days more than ever, high-speed internet is a necessity, not a luxury for work. It's 11/5; the front desk says there has been a ”nationwide outage” of high-speed internet at all Marriotts since 10/15 (there isn't. There probably is a problem with their ISP, but not what the front desk seems to believe). The ”regular” internet doesn't even pull 1 mbps consistently. There's nothing they can do, and now I'm faced with either having to cancel work meetings because I can't get a decent connection or check out and risk not having them refund me the rest of my stay and go find somewhere else with internet. I know that they can't help how the ISP runs, but they had the power to warn guests ahead of time and offer the option to back out of the reservation and stay somewhere else.
